Hello all,
anybody knows how can I extract equations from Xilinx schematic?
I tried in Schematic Editor: Option->ExportNetlist and VHD file has been
generated...but to get clear equations (Out=f(In)) I must translate whole of
file...

Maybe somhere is tool for extracting euations from VHDL file?

Do you need them into vhdl ? Otherwise you can perhaps use edif2blif to
generate a blif file.
Maybe somhere is tool for extracting euations from VHDL file?
The official level of input is a transistor netlist, but you can look
for TLL product from TransEDA/TNI-Valiosys
Perhaps do you have a way to keep your netlist as input.

TLL can make you a VHDL or a Verilog file with sequential process and
combinatory process.

Then you have your equations.
